Hypericin is a photosensitive natural compound (C30H16O8) used in biochemical research as an inhibitor of protein kinase C (PKC) and monoamine oxidase (MAO). It is applied in studies of apoptosis, phototoxicity, antiviral activity, and antidepressant mechanisms, and is supplied as a solid or solution for in vitro experiments.
- Used as a PKC and MAO inhibitor in biochemical research.
- CAS number 548-04-9; molecular weight 504.44 g/mol.
- Purity typically 98.0% and appears as a brown to black solid.
- Soluble in DMSO (≈250 mg/mL with warming and ultrasonication).
- Storage: powder at -20°C (up to 3 years) or 4°C (up to 2 years); solutions -80°C (up to 6 months).
